An interesting find from a Chinese collector, this Japanese vase is glazed both inside and out as its intended purpose is for ikebana (flower arrangement). The surface has been painted with bamboo patterns using iron-pigmented paints, a tradition found in Japan and Korea and difficult to find elsewhere. The special pigment shines a dull iron-red under light.
